The Role

Passenger Assistants are vital in supporting young people with special educational needs, ensuring a safe environment during journeys from/to home and school.

You will ensure passengers board and are secured on vehicles such as buses or taxis, and oversee their safety, behaviour, and wellbeing.

Relevant training will be provided for this rewarding role.


Contract Details

We offer 15-hour term-time contracts with core hours from 7:30 am to 9:00 am and 2:45 pm to 4:15 pm, Monday to Friday.

Casual Passenger Assistants are also recruited to cover sickness, holidays, and busy periods.


About You

You should be able to work with children and adults with various needs, demonstrating dignity and respect, and communicate effectively with parents and carers.

Essential qualities include compassion, flexibility, motivation, and the ability to follow instructions and remain calm in emergencies.

You must be physically fit to run, bend, stretch, push, pull, lift, carry, and kneel as required.

Good organization skills and adaptability to changing situations are also important.

This role offers the chance to make a positive difference in the lives of children, young people, and their families.
